What's Happening?
Amon-Ra St. Brown, a wide receiver for the Detroit Lions, emerged as a top performer in fantasy football during Week 2, scoring 39.20 points. His performance included three touchdown receptions, placing him among the highest scorers in the league. As Week 3 approaches, St. Brown is projected to face the Baltimore Ravens, with analysts predicting another strong performance due to his frequent slot alignment and favorable matchups. The Lions' quarterback, Jared Goff, also contributed significantly with 33.96 fantasy points, highlighting the team's offensive strength.
